Shared bicycle that can be charged conveniently

The present disclosure relates to a shared bicycle that can be charged conveniently. The bicycle includes a front fork, a rear fork, a handle mounted on the front fork, a shopping basket mounted on the handle, a solar panel mounted on the shopping basket, and a smart lock mounted on the rear fork. The bicycle further includes a bus for data transmission and charging. One end of the bus is electrically connected to the smart lock, and the other end of the bus is configured with an interface that can be connected to an external circuit. The interface is mounted on the shopping basket. The solar panel is connected to the bus via a wire. The interface of the bus is mounted on the shopping basket without disassembling the cover plate, which provides a large operable space and makes it convenient for charging and data transmission, thereby improving the rescue efficiency.

System and method for securing, recharging and operating an electric bicycle

A securing system for securing an electric bicycle to a bicycle docking frame includes a female connecting assembly mountable on the bicycle docking frame and a male connecting assembly mountable on the electric bicycle and sized to be received within a tapered recess of the female connecting assembly. When so received, first current coupling elements of the female assembly electrically interface with second current coupling elements of the male assembly, which can allow current flow therebetween to charge a battery of the electric bicycle. A bicycle rack system includes electric bicycles, bicycle docks, a charging module operable to receive electrical power from an external power source and a charging controller for adjusting the level of electrical power provided to dock-side charging modules that charge battery modules of electric bicycles docked thereto. A method for managing charging is also provided. An electric bicycle is operable to receive a user ride profile from an external device and a motor control module thereof is operable to adjust operation of the motor of the electric bicycle based on the user ride profile.

COLLAPSIBLE BICYCLE
20230331327 · 2023-10-19 ·

A collapsible bicycle includes a collapsible tube, a spring-loaded detent, a rod, a hook, and a security element. The collapsible tube includes a first section, a second section, and a hinge for pivotally connecting the first and second sections to each other. The spring-loaded detent is connected to the second section of the collapsible tube and formed with an external end. The rod is connected to the second section of the collapsible tube. The hook is pivotally connected to the first section and formed with a hook engageable with the rod to keep the first and second sections of the collapsible tube coaxial with each other. The security element is pivotally connected to the first section of the collapsible tube and formed with a concave portion for receiving the spring-loaded detent to keep the security element covering the hook, thereby keeping the hook engaged with the rod.

3-position battery latching system

An ebike includes a front wheel, a rear wheel, a frame assembly supported on the front wheel and the rear wheel, a battery, and a battery latching assembly to secure the battery to the frame assembly. The battery latching assembly includes a latch member movable among (1) a secured position in which the latch member is configured to secure the battery in a fully mounted position, (2) an open position in which the latch member is configured to maintain the battery in a partially mounted position, and (3) a released position in which the latch member is configured to release the battery. The battery latching assembly also includes a release member coupled to the latch member and movable among (1) a first position in which the latch member is maintained in the secured position, (2) a second position in which the latch member is maintained in the open position and (3) a third position in which the latch member is maintained in the release position.

CHARGING DEVICE FOR PERSONAL MOBILITY MEANS

The present invention relates to a charging device for a personal mobility means. More specifically, the present invention may comprise support parts each having a slot in which a wheel of a personal mobility means is seated; a frame part connecting the support parts to each other; a first charging unit disposed in the frame part to generate a magnetic field for wireless charging toward the personal mobility means seated in the support parts; and a second charging unit mounted to the personal mobility means and converting the magnetic field, received via the first charging unit, into power to charge a battery provided in the personal mobility means.

HOLDING DEVICE FOR RELEASABLY SUPPORTING AN ENERGY STORE ON A FRAME, IN PARTICULAR, ON A BICYCLE FRAME
20220281554 · 2022-09-08 ·

A holding device for releasably supporting an energy store, in particular, an energy store for a bicycle, on a frame, in particular, on a bicycle frame. The holding device includes at least one locking unit, which is intended, in a locked state, for axially fixing the energy store in position and releasably locking it. The locking unit includes at least one first locking element and at least one second locking element corresponding to the first locking element.

Saddle type electric vehicle

A saddle type electric vehicle (1) includes a charging cord (245) that is connectable to an external power supply, a cord accommodating section (230) configured to accommodate a charging cord (245), and a step floor (9) on which an occupant places his/her legs, a center tunnel (CT) bulging above the step floor (9) is provided in front of a front end of a seat (8) and below a handle (2), and the cord accommodating section (230) is disposed in the center tunnel (CT).

Cable lock systems and methods

A smart cable lock is provided that is configured to mechanically secure items and provide an automatic determination that securing is achieved. The smart cable may be integrated into a vehicle, or otherwise may communicate with a vehicle. The vehicle includes one or more ports configured to house the cable when not in use. In some embodiments, an accessory includes one or more ports configured to engage with the connector. In some embodiments, the cable is affixed to the vehicle at one end, using a retractor, for example, and can be unspooled, intertwined with equipment, and then secured to a port on the vehicle. The smart cable lock secures and releases a latch based on user indications and authorizations. For example, if the cable is destroyed or damaged, or an unauthorized indication is made, the cable lock system may sound an alarm, or otherwise alert the user.

Swinging locking mechanism for bicycle rack and bicycle rack having the same
11383779 · 2022-07-12 · ·

A swinging locking mechanism configured to be mounted to a bicycle rack includes a movable rod configured to be movably mounted to a pivot seat of the bicycle rack, and an operating member. The movable rod defines an axial direction and includes at least one second engaging portion which is releasably engaged with at least one first engaging portion of the pivot seat. The operating member is connected with the at least one second engaging portion, and an operational direction of the operating member is parallel to the axial direction. The bicycle rack including the swinging locking mechanism is further provided, and further includes: a carrying frame, having at least one of the pivot seat and configured to carry at least one bicycle. The movable rod is transverse to the carrying frame and configured to restrict the at least one bicycle.
